Right-angled Triangles, SM-Bank 001 MC

Henry flies a kite attached to a long string, as shown in the diagram below.
 

The horizontal distance of the kite to Henry’s hand is 8 m.

The vertical distance of the kite above Henry’s hand is 15 m.

The length of the string, in metres, is

  1.  13
  2.  17
  3.  23
  4.  289

\(\text{Using Pythagoras}\)

\(s^2\) \(= 8^2 + 15^2\)
  \(= 289\)
\(\therefore\ s\) \(=\sqrt{289}\)
  \(= 17\ \text{metres}\)

  \(\Rightarrow B\)
